WebApr 15, 2024 · For example, if company X issues an IPO of 20,000 shares, triggering a demand for 40,000 shares, then the X IPO can be said to be oversubscribed two times. Typically, underwriters set prices of shares or bonds on offer through an IPO in such a way as to preempt either a shortage or a surplus of offered securities.
